The Episcopal Church is the U.S. member of the worldwide Anglican Communion, offering a rich liturgical tradition rooted in the Book of Common Prayer — first compiled in 1549 and revised in 1979. Episcopal worship at its most traditional is among the most aesthetically rich in American Christianity: vested clergy, choral music, and the measured cadences of the BCP. The Eucharist is celebrated every Sunday. All visitors are welcomed warmly. New York is home to at least 6 episcopal congregations listed in the NearFaith directory.
